| 3/27/26 | ![]() Bec Fox = Wild Fox | In this conversation we have the absolute pleasure and privilege of chatting with Bec Fox, a self proclaimed 'wild fox'. Foxy's relationship with the natural world began from very young age, free roaming the family farm which her parents were regenerating. This deep connection to the land led to Bec's love of nature, going ahead and establishing nature camps for city kids from age thirteen. There was little doubt with this upbringing Bec was destined to work in the outdoors... | 43m 07s | |
| 2/17/26 | ![]() Mick Ramsay - Snow Ploughing to Glory | The title of this episode alludes to Mick's laconic, often understated attitude to his life as an outdoor educator and hardcore adventurer in the nature space. A self described lover of the outdoors and what it has to teach all humans, he regales the audience with tales of: solo surfing trips, sea kayaking Bass Strait and the connections with the awesome people that a life filled with adventurers outside has provided. Yet all his tales are filled with a wry humour, respect ... | 32m 52s | |
| 1/14/26 | ![]() Vertical Direction Nature Connection - John Beede | In this episode we chat with John Beede who is a world class adventurer and one truely great human. John has climbed the 7 Summits, has written books, is a motivational speaker and currently facilitates men's retreats, yet in this candid conversation punctuated with humility and humour he opens his soul to our audience. It is so beautifully uplifting to hear such an accomplished mountaineer, perhaps an outdoor guru, share stories of natural connection and transce... | 38m 35s | |
| 12/2/25 | ![]() An Outdoor Love Story | Dr. Jackie Kiewa and Dr. Trevor Robertson are astounding outdoor adventurers always leading with humility, wisdom and grace. In this episode they regale the listening audience with tales spanning many decades of adventure encompassing multi pitch climbing, whitewater kayaking in Siberia and how humility has led them to enjoy the journey in their later years. Now with Trev almost an octogenarian these two self described casual adventurers speak candidly about having slowed do... | 51m 04s | |
